Cast Iron Mermaid Wall Hook with Verdigris Finish

This item is a wall-mounted decorative hook fashioned in the form of a classical mermaid. It is constructed from cast iron, characterized by its heavy, dense weight and coarse, granulated surface texture visible throughout the piece. The finish is a decorative verdigris patina, featuring a teal or seafoam green coloration that mimics oxidized copper or bronze. The figure depicts a mermaid with her left arm raised behind her head and her right arm resting on her hip, with the lower fish-like tail curling forward to create an functional hook. Each scale on the tail and the individual strands of hair are rendered with moderate detail in the mold. Notably, there is visible surface rust and oxidation appearing as reddish-brown patches on the face, chest, and tail fin, which suggests the piece may have been exposed to moisture or is intentionally aged to appear antique. The craftsmanship is typical of mass-produced garden or coastal-themed hardware from the late 20th to early 21st century. No maker's marks are visible on the front, and the back likely features a flat surface with screw holes for mounting.
